+Sustainable Windows: A Comprehensive Guide to Eco-Friendly Secondary Glazing Materials
As the global focus shifts towards sustainability and carbon footprint decrease, property owners and home designers are significantly inspecting the ecological effect of structure materials. While secondary glazing has actually long been recognized as an economical method to improve thermal performance and minimize sound, the conversation has just recently evolved to consist of the "green" qualifications of the materials utilized in its building.
Selecting eco-friendly materials for secondary glazing is no longer just a specific niche choice; it is a crucial part of sustainable architecture. This post explores the various sustainable materials available, their advantages, and how they add to a circular economy.
The Role of Secondary Glazing in Sustainability
[Secondary Glazing Solutions](https://moiafazenda.ru/user/waxsunday05/) glazing includes the setup of an extra pane of glass and a frame on the interior side of an existing window. From an environmental perspective, it is typically remarkable to complete window replacement because it avoids the "embodied energy" cost of producing entirely new window units and the waste associated with disposing of old frames.
By making use of environmentally friendly materials, home owners can further lower their environmental effect, ensuring that the process of conserving energy does not come at the cost of high commercial pollution or non-recyclable waste.
Key Eco-Friendly Materials in Secondary Glazing
When examining the sustainability of secondary glazing, one need to think about both the framing materials and the glazing media itself. Here are the primary materials leading the method in environmentally friendly building and construction.
1. Recycled Aluminum
Aluminum is among the most popular products for secondary glazing frames due to its strength, slim profile, and resilience. Nevertheless, main aluminum production is energy-intensive. Thankfully, aluminum is 100% recyclable without any loss of quality.
Low Energy Consumption: Producing recycled aluminum requires just 5% of the energy required to create "virgin" aluminum.Boundless Longevity: It can be recycled repeatedly, making it a foundation of the circular economy.Durability: Its resistance to corrosion makes sure that the frames last for decades, reducing the requirement for replacement.2. Sustainably Sourced Timber
For heritage properties or those looking for a natural visual, wood is a top choice. When sourced properly, wood is the most sustainable framing product offered.
Carbon Sequestration: Trees absorb CO2 as they grow, and this carbon stays locked in the lumber throughout its life as a window frame.Certifications: To be truly environmentally friendly, timber needs to bring accreditation from the Forest Stewardship Council (FSC) or the Programme for the Endorsement of Forest Certification (PEFC).Biodegradability: At the end of its long life cycle, wood is biodegradable and does not contribute to garbage dump crises.3. Bio-Based and Recycled Plastics
While traditional uPVC has actually dealt with criticism for its chemical structure, the industry has actually seen the increase of recycled polymers and bio-based plastics. These products provide the insulation benefits of plastic while reducing ecological damage by repurposing existing waste.
4. High-Performance, Recyclable Glass
The glass itself has seen substantial technological leaps. Modern secondary glazing often utilizes "Low-E" (low emissivity) glass, which includes a microscopic metal oxide finish that shows heat back into the room.
Recycled Content: Many makers now incorporate a high portion of "cullet" (recycled glass) into their assembly line.Vacuum Glazing: This is a more recent technology where the air between 2 thin panes is removed to develop a vacuum, offering the thermal efficiency of triple glazing with a portion of the material density and weight.Contrast of Secondary Glazing Materials

Decrease in Energy Consumption
The primary objective of secondary glazing is to create an insulating layer of air between the primary window and the secondary pane. By utilizing eco-friendly Low-E glass, the thermal efficiency can be improved by up to 60%. This results in:
Lower heating costs.Minimized demand on the electrical grid or gas supplies.A substantial decrease in the household's annual carbon footprint.Preservation of Existing Structures
One of the most sustainable acts in construction is the conservation of existing materials. [Professional Secondary Glazing](https://notes.bmcs.one/s/zrHgwuHY__) glazing enables original, frequently antique, windows to stay in location. This prevents the main windows from entering the waste stream and maintains the architectural heritage of a structure without sacrificing contemporary convenience.
Sound Pollution Mitigation
Ecological quality isn't simply about carbon; it is likewise about the living environment. Sustainable secondary glazing offers superior acoustic insulation. Quality products like thick laminated glass or specialized acoustic glass can minimize external sound by up to 80%, contributing to better psychological health and wellness for occupants in urban locations.
Waste Reduction
Sustainable makers concentrate on "closed-loop" systems. This implies they reclaim off-cuts from the setup procedure and recycle them into new products. Selecting a provider with a robust recycling policy ensures that very little waste is sent out to landfills during the setup procedure.
Factors to consider for Choosing a Sustainable Supplier
When choosing a provider for secondary glazing, consumers should try to find particular indicators of environmental obligation:
Life Cycle Assessment (LCA): Does the business understand the ecological effect of their item from "cradle to grave"?Local Manufacturing: Choosing a local provider minimizes the carbon emissions associated with the transport and shipping of heavy glass and metal.Non-Toxic Sealants: Inquire whether the sealants and finishes utilized throughout setup are low in Volatile Organic Compounds (VOCs), which add to much better indoor air quality.

Often Asked Questions (FAQ)1. Is secondary glazing better for the environment than double glazing?
In many cases, yes. While double glazing offers outstanding insulation, the procedure of removing and dealing with old windows develops significant waste. [Secondary Glazing Efficiency](http://bbs.xingxiancn.com/home.php?mod=space&uid=850697) glazing makes use of the existing window, requires fewer basic materials, and includes less embodied energy throughout manufacturing.
2. Can recycled aluminum frames hold heavy glass?
Absolutely. Recycled aluminum maintains the very same structural integrity as virgin aluminum. It is exceptionally strong and can quickly support heavy acoustic or toughened glass without deforming or bending.
3. The length of time do environment-friendly secondary glazing products last?
Products such as cured lumber and aluminum are designed for durability. Aluminum frames can last upwards of 40 years with very little maintenance, while well-maintained timber can last 30 to 50 years.
4. Does environmentally friendly secondary glazing cost more?
While some premium sustainable materials (like Accoya wood or vacuum-sealed glass) may have a higher in advance expense, the energy cost savings and the durability of the materials normally lead to a lower overall expense of ownership over the product's lifespan.
5. Can I utilize environmentally friendly secondary glazing in a Listed Building?
Yes. Secondary glazing is normally the preferred approach for improving insulation in Listed Buildings due to the fact that it is "reversible" and does not alter the external fabric of the historical window. Using sustainable lumber frames is frequently the best method to match the visual requirements of heritage authorities.
